cowboy bebop Posted May 22, 2008 Share Posted May 22, 2008 Hi gents, After inspecting a set of cams that came in, I've decided to snap a few up close shots of them so you guys can see exactly what you're getting. The advertised duration is 268, the duration @ .050 is 226, and the lift is 9.14mm. top shelf quality all around.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...

Chris Wilson Posted May 22, 2008 Share Posted May 22, 2008 Are they ground off new blanks with stock base circle diameter? What heat treatment have they had? Cheers.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
cowboy bebop Posted May 22, 2008 Author Share Posted May 22, 2008 Right, right. They're made from stock cores and the base circles are left intact so minimal if any reshimming is required assuming the cores came from the motor being used. Only the lobes are altered to give more lift and more duration. Thanks! Eric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
cowboy bebop Posted May 22, 2008 Author Share Posted May 22, 2008 Are they ground off new blanks with stock base circle diameter? What heat treatment have they had? Cheers. The base circle is stock since they're made from stock cores. Currently there's no blanks for the exhaust cam. The cams are hard welded and are tough as a coffin nail, however what they do to harden the material afterwards I'll have to inquire. Suffice it to say though that the lobes are harder than the shims/buckets. Thanks! Eric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
